What is a data warehouse?

A data warehouse is a place where you collect all the data you have from different sources.

Let’s say you run a blog on WordPress and have Google Analytics installed, and you use Autopilot for your email marketing and Optimizely to run A/B tests on your website. And then you’re keeping customer data in your CRM.

That’s a lot of data from a lot of different sources.

How do you connect the dots?

With a… tadaaa: data warehouse!

A data warehouse copies the data from all these different sources and stores it in one central repository.

The hot shit data warehouses today are:

  • Amazon Redshift
  • Google BigQuery
  • MySQL
  • Postgres

A data warehouse is basically a central repository of data from different sources. The reason why you want this centralized is that it makes working with the data easier: it makes it easier to create reports and analyze the data.

Here’s a helpful video that explains the concept of a data warehouse, and why it’s important for businesses:

